Step 1
To the bowl of a food processor, add ham, egg, sweet pickles, pickle juice, pepper, and mayonnaise. Pulse for 12 - 15 times until ham is finely chopped.
Step 2
Place ham mixture in a medium-size bowl. Fold in chopped celery. Taste and adjust seasoning. Cover and place ham salad in the refrigerator to chill for 1 hour before serving.
Step 3
***a sharp knife can be used to chop ham, egg, and pickles if no food processor is available.
